What is personification?

Back

Personification is a figure of speech in which human qualities are attributed to animals, inanimate objects, or abstract concepts. Example: 'The wind whispered through the trees.'

What is an allusion?

Back

An allusion is a reference to a well-known person, place, event, literary work, or work of art. Example: 'He was a real Romeo with the ladies.'

What is a simile?

Back

A simile is a figure of speech that compares two different things using the words 'like' or 'as'. Example: 'Her smile was as bright as the sun.'

What is a metaphor?

Back

A metaphor is a figure of speech that makes a direct comparison between two unlike things by stating that one is the other. Example: 'Time is a thief.'

What is hyperbole?

Back

Hyperbole is an exaggerated statement not meant to be taken literally. Example: 'I’m so hungry I could eat a horse.'

What is the purpose of figurative language in songs?

Back

Figurative language enhances the emotional impact, creates imagery, and conveys deeper meanings in songs.

How does personification affect the meaning of a song?

Back

Personification can create emotional connections and vivid imagery, making the lyrics more relatable and impactful.
